JUMLA, Nov 25: Pujan Kumar Upadhyay, a 10th grader at Kanakasundari Secondary School of Jumla sat for his terminal examinations recently. He performed poorly. In the examinations, he was asked questions from the chapters which were not taught by the teachers yet. "It was the same for English, Maths and Science. We were asked questions from the chapters which were never discussed in the classroom," he reported.

ITAHARI, Nov 25: The number of birds in Koshi Tappu Wildlife Reserve (KTWR) has been decreasing in the recent times. Wildlife experts attribute this to the decreased in water levels in ponds and rivers, and lack of food for the birds in the reserve.
